- Megan Rapinoe is an American professional football player who plays as a winger. Megan, one of six siblings, grew up in Redding, California. At college, she was a star player but tore a ligament for the second time in 2007, which could have ended her career. Having come back from injury, she turned professional and was the second overall pick in the 2008 draft. She has played her club football in America - most notably in Seattle - Australia and France. She has also played well over 100 games for the USA women's national team, winning an Olympic gold medal and a World Cup. Rapinoe is a prominent LGBTQ rights' activist and was awarded the Board of Directors Award by the Los Angeles Gay and Lesbian Center in, 2012, for raising awareness of LGBTQ people in sport.- IMDb Mini Biography By: Amazon Studios

- [2019] Became the first openly gay woman in the annual swimsuit issue of Sports Illustrated.
- She has a twin sister named Rachael.
- Since 2016, she is in a relationship with basketball player Sue Bird.
- [7 July 2022] Awarded the Presidential Medal of Freedom by President Joe Biden in a ceremony in the East Room of the White House.
